Step 6: Deploy the reminder job for the Bramwick Clinic scheduler. The job runs hourly and sends appointment reminders through the Hollyfern notification gateway. Verify the cron entry matches the staging copy, and confirm the quiet-hours window (21:00–07:00) is enabled before going live. Once those checks pass, upload the signing key listed directly below this step.

rollout seal: bky4_x7Gc

## Wiki RBAC quick notes (for Thursday sync)

Quick reminder: role grants on Leafbook wiki are managed in the perms service, not the wiki UI — edits there get overwritten hourly. If someone's locked out, check the role_map table before touching anything else. To inspect it, use the read replica via the connection string below.

database URL for bagap-yahap: mysql://druax_svc:s0i8rHw@db-fdc1.orvexworks.local:5432/druius

## 2.9.0 — Key rotation

Rotated the signing key used by the canary gating pipeline. Under the updated gating rules, a canary must hold error rates below threshold for 45 minutes across two regions before Driftgate promotes it, and every promoted artifact is re-signed at that step. Support: if a customer reports a verification failure on builds after this release, have them validate against the new key below.

signing key of bagap-yawep = bky13_TbfT6ZMUoGJo2

## Deployment

The Copperkiln transcode farm deploys as a fleet of stateless workers plus one coordinator per region. Workers pull jobs from the Ashgate queue, so you can roll them in any order; the coordinator requires a drain-and-swap. Use the deploy script in ops/, which validates presets before pushing. New contractors should deploy to the sandbox region first and run the smoke encode job. Each environment reads its settings from a mounted config file at startup. The production values currently deployed are listed below.

deployment values, fahap-hahaf:
[casdor]
port = 9200
region = south-2
host = casdor.qirvanworks.corp
timeout_ms = 3000
retries = 4